When Money Is Involved

Deposit, withdrawal, cryptocurrency transfer, or transaction-status questions may require information such as a transaction ID, wallet address used for the transfer, asset, amount, and approximate time.

Never send a private wallet key or recovery phrase when discussing a payment.

Before You Send a Message

Use the channel that best matches the issue, provide enough information to identify the case, and keep sensitive credentials private.

CoinCasino support should never require your password, private cryptocurrency key, seed phrase, or one-time authentication code in order to investigate a standard support request.
